Some SEOs have started discussing how AI Overviews may be changing the way users interact with search results.
When the AI-generated summary appears at the top of the page, it often provides a direct explanation to the query before users even reach the traditional list of links. This slightly changes the layout of the search results page.
Several early studies and industry reports suggest that when an AI Overview is present, organic click behavior may shift. In some cases analysts have mentioned potential declines in the range of 20–30% for certain informational queries.
At the same time, AI summaries often reference sources when generating answers. This means that visibility may not depend only on ranking position but also on whether a site becomes one of the cited sources.
Of course it is still early and AI search features continue evolving quickly. But it does raise an interesting question about how organic traffic patterns may change as AI-generated summaries appear more frequently in search results.
